We are offering a Postdoctoral Position (m/f/d) in Targeted Drug Delivery
Job Description
Specific targeting and endosomal escape still remain crucial hurdles for the successful implementation of macromolecules as therapeutics. The know-how in endocytosis positions the group at the leading edge of understanding what drives these limitations and identifying novel ways to overcome these obstacles.
This project aims to translate novel targeting ideas identified into applications for oligonucleotide delivery. It concerns antibody production against identified targets and their attachment to oligonucleotides and nanoparticles. Their uptake and trafficking will be studied in cell lines and primary cells in vitro and in mouse models in vivo, using quantitative light microscopy and high throughput screening approaches. The project will be carried out in collaboration with the pharmaceutical industry.
